OS XDescription of the issue
Inside a portal, when a popover button is layered under a container field so that is it not visible on the layout, a user is still able to access the popover button by clicking in the container field area where the popover button resides beneath.If the user clicks in that vicinity, a popover will appear as if the user clicked the popover button directly.
Steps to reproduce the problem
On a layout create a portal > Create a popover button. > Then create a container field that is larger than the popover button. > Place the container field over the popover button and use the inspector tool if necessary so that the container field is above the popover button and completely covers it so that in Browse mode, a user cannot see the popover button. > Now go into Browse mode and hover over the container field area where the popover button resides beneath. > Click in that area and notice that a popover button will open.Expected result
Since the container field is above the popover button, the user should not be able to open a popover window when they click on the container field.Actual result
The user is able to open a popover window when they click on the container field. Notice that the container field is not even grouped with the popover button.Exact text of any error message(s) that appear
n/aConfiguration information
n/aWorkaround
In order for me to avoid this, I have to hide the popover button under the container field under certain conditions if I don't want the user to be able to open a popover window.Screenshot
